Things to do in Jamestown?
Jamestown is a city located in the south western corner of New York State on the shores of Chautauqua Lake. This dynamic town features many attractions for visitors including a variety of shopping options, art galleries and theaters. Outdoor lovers can also access local parks for swimming or boating on the lake during summertime.

Things to do in Newington?
Newington, CT is a town in Hartford County, Connecticut. It has a population of about 28,000 and is known for its beautiful parks and rich history. The town is located close to the state capital of Hartford and is a great place for those who are looking for small-town living with easy access to urban areas.
